What is the reflection of the point (6, -1) in the line y = 2?

This question was previously asked in
SSC CGL 2017 (Tier 1) Previous Year Paper (16-Aug-2017) (Shift 1)
The correct answer is

(6, 5)

For reflection of a point \((x, y)\) in a horizontal line \(y = k\), the x-coordinate is unchanged and the y-coordinate becomes \(2k - y\).

With \((x, y) = (6, -1)\) and \(k = 2\):

\[y' = 2(2) - (-1) = 4 + 1 = 5\]

Therefore the reflection is (6, 5).
